China's AI-related industries to top 10 trln yuan by 2030: official

Xinhua, March 09, 2026 Adjust font size:

China's artificial intelligence (AI) related industries will be valued at more than 10 trillion yuan (1.45 trillion U.S. dollars) by the end of the 15th Five-Year Plan period (2026-2030), Zheng Shanjie, head of the National Development and Reform Commission, said Friday.

The country will continue to advance its "AI Plus" initiative during the period, he told a press conference on the sidelines of the fourth session of the 14th National People's Congress.
